  • It's not entirely impossible that there could be corruption on your system drive, but I don't think that's the likeliest option. If you want to completely remove Transmission and the plugin and you've installed the plugin from OMV then issuing apt-get autoremove --purge openmediavault-transmissionbt should normally be enough. That will purge the plugin and all it dependencies.


    What I think you're seeing and the reason to why it worked before, but not now is a change with later versions of the plugin (or rather, a reverted change to how the original plugin actually worked). The plugin used to add the user debian-transmission to the users group (which means that it would've worked for you now since users has enough permissions). If you look at the NAS it's working on I would guess that issuing groups debian-transmission will show the users group. The issue with that is that system users shouldn't be added to the users group without the consent of the administrator since it can be a security issue (think of malfunctioning services having the access to all files and directories which the users group has access to).


    So, what you can do is multiple things. You can either add debian-transmission to the users group (which I personally wouldn't do), or you can use ACLs to manage permissions. The con with the second option is that ACLs sometimes can be hard to work with. The third option (which I use) is to create a new group, for example download-adm and add the user debian-transmission to it. Then you change the group of the download directory to your new group instead and it should work. Now you can add all users that should be able to manage downloads to the new group and everything should work as you've intended. For read only access you can then set permissions to read only for others.

  • You're nearly there if I'm seeing it correctly. You just need to fix this drwxrwxrw- 7 mastro users 4096 Oct 18 16:47 ... That means that /media still is missing executable rights for others. Run the two commands I gave you and see if it works after it. You don't normally want /media world writable, but that's of course up to you. :)
